Another format which has aroused interest the most in the daytime<br />
broadcast in recent years is "marriage programs". In Turkey, where marriage is<br />
one of the most fundamental social values, any assistance or support provided<br />
to single people to enable them to find suitable spouses is considered to be a<br />
very important proof of solidarity. Besides, in these programs the people who<br />
want to get married teli their life stories. Thus, their content resembles that of<br />
dramas. In this sense, it is possible to say that these programs are the televised<br />
versions of whatis being experienced among neighbors and friends in real life.<br />
Commenting on these programs, the President of R TSC said "They fulfill a<br />
social function". Y et, w e cannot say that the se programs have no ad verse<br />
effects. S ome of the participants have committed erime s by taking advantage of<br />
the program ( e.g., some committed fraud or theft with the pretext of marriage;<br />
some attempted to carry out "white marriage" to obtain citizenship ). Besi des,<br />
women's groups fighting against sexismin the media eriticize these programs<br />
because most of the female participants want financial assurance (like<br />
properties) as a requirement from possible husbands and the TV programıners<br />
just take this for granted.<br />
